Author: robert
Date: 2008-02-07 01:05:03 +0000 (Thu, 07 Feb 2008)
New Revision: 17637
Modified:
trunk/freenet/src/freenet/node/NetworkIDManager.java
Log:
send positive acknowledgement of successful store
Modified: trunk/freenet/src/freenet/node/NetworkIDManager.java
===================================================================
--- trunk/freenet/src/freenet/node/NetworkIDManager.java 2008-02-07
01:01:47 UTC (rev 17636)
+++ trunk/freenet/src/freenet/node/NetworkIDManager.java 2008-02-07
01:05:03 UTC (rev 17637)
@@ -47,6 +47,11 @@
StoredSecret s=new StoredSecret(pn, uid, secret);
Logger.error(this, "Storing secret: "+s);
addOrReplaceSecret(s);
+ try {
+ pn.sendAsync(DMT.createFNPAccepted(uid), null, 0, null);
+ } catch (NotConnectedException e) {
+ Logger.error(this, "peer disconnected before
storeSecret ack?", e);
+ }
return true;
}